I wonder if it may be a resolution issue since there doesn't seem to be any connection tied with brand or drivers... I tested this with my systems that are running Windows 7, here are the results:

One of my desktops using Windows 7

evga Geforce GTX 260 Core 216 SC @ 1920x1200 = Effected :(

HP elitebook #1 Windows 7

Quadro FX1800 @ 1680x1050 = No issues :)

HP elitebook #2 Windows 7

Quadro FX1800 @ 1920x1200 = Effected :(

The two 1920x1200 are effected whereas the other one isn't. I would test further but my other systems are running Vista.

Can anyone else confirm with resolution results?

edit: using 190.62 nvidia drivers. Also just a note; the issue did NOT turn up right away with the elitebook #2 - it took a few tries to recreate it.
